Scutellaria baicalensis cultivation method
Technical Field
The invention relates to a method for cultivating medicinal plants, in particular to a method for cultivating scutellaria baicalensis.
Background
The scutellaria is a large amount of common traditional Chinese medicinal materials, has a long application history, has the functions of clearing heat and drying dampness, purging fire and removing toxicity, stopping bleeding and preventing miscarriage, and is sold at home and abroad. The root of Baikal skullcap root is used as medicine. For wild, scutellaria grows on gravelly or clay hills, mountain tops, grasslands, hilly slopes, grasslands, and also on relatively arid barren hills, and grassland type gravely mountain sunny slopes. It is favorable to mild weather and illumination, drought and cold resistant, and is suitable for growth of neutral or alkaline, loose and fertile soil. The wild plants are in a dispersed state and are difficult to harvest, so that the wild plants are difficult to meet the increasing market demands. Therefore, the development of an artificial cultivation yellow answer is necessary.

Detailed Description
Embodiment 1, a scutellaria baicalensis cultivation method, comprising the steps of selecting land, collecting seeds, raising seedlings, transplanting or dividing plants, managing the field, preventing and treating diseases and insect pests, harvesting and adding soil, is carried out according to the following method:
1. selecting land: the scutellaria baicalensis is cultivated to take the hillside land which has good drainage, fertile humus soil and sandy soil, the surface soil is deep and soft, and the lower soil contains gravel as the planting land;
2. seed collection and seedling raising: selecting a well-developed 2-3 year old plant as a seed collecting parent plant, gradually maturing fruits in 9 months, collecting, drying and storing, or mixing with soil and sand, burying in soil, selecting a place with warm climate and good sunlight irradiation, arranging a seedbed, turning over the soil, smashing soil blocks, simultaneously applying thoroughly decomposed compost, human excrement and plant ash as base fertilizers, applying 2500 kg per mu, fully mixing with the soil, arranging a furrow with the width of 100-200 cm, determining the length of the furrow according to the visible terrain, adopting broadcasting or strip sowing from 3 lower ten days to 4 middle days of the sowing period, wherein the sowing period is uniform in density, the strip sowing distance is 7-10 cm, covering a thin soil layer after sowing, covering straw on the soil surface, preventing the furrow surface from drying and hardening, ensuring that the seeds germinate well, removing the covered grass after germination, and removing small seedlings if weeds occur in the dense growth part of the seedlings, the seedlings also need to be pulled out at any time, excrement and urine are applied for 1-2 times in the seedling raising period, and the seedlings can be planted when growing for 13-17 cm;
3. transplanting: in the field planting and transplanting period of 9 months in autumn or 4-5 months in spring, the land is bedded before planting, the width of the land is 67 cm, and the plant spacing is 23-26 cm. Selecting well-developed strong seedlings, loading 1 plant in each hole, covering soil and lightly pressing to enable roots to be tightly combined with soil;
4. field management, (1) soil loosening and weeding: after the seedlings are planted and survive, weeding is carried out at any time, soil loosening and earthing up are carried out for 2-3 times, the soil loosening is shallow, and the roots are not damaged so as to avoid rotting; (2) fertilizing: composting for base fertilizer, applying 500-1000 kg of fertilizer per mu, applying human excrement and ammonium sulfate for topdressing, and applying topdressing for 2-3 times in stages during the growth period; (3) removing buds: when the flower buds occur, the flower buds are removed in time to promote the development and growth of roots.
5. And (3) pest control: mainly comprises leaf blight, a control method, wherein 1000 times of 50% carbendazim wettable powder is used in the early stage of disease attack or 1: 1: spraying 120 Bordeaux mixture for 1 time every 7-14 days and continuously for 2-3 times;
6. harvesting and processing, wherein the scutellaria baicalensis can be harvested 2-3 years after being planted, harvested in spring and autumn, the roots are dug, the overground parts and soil are removed, the seeds are dried to be semi-dry, the skins are removed, and the seeds are dried to be completely dry.
